Job Description:

You will work in the area of Bosch Development Cloud and help creating a stable and future-proof platform for cloud-based software development for all business units at Bosch.

Job Responsibility:

  • Design and implement concepts for the stable, automated operation for cloud services within the Bosch Development Cloud
  • Understand the requirements of internal customers and users in regards to visionary development approaches
  • Contribute to the strengthening of world-wide distributed Continuous Integration / Continuous Delivery environments in the cloud
  • Ensure that the services are secure, scalable, reliable and monitored

Requirements:

  • Professional experience in software development or related discipline
  • Strong experience in automation frameworks (e.g. Jenkins, GitHub Actions, Azure DevOps)
  • Experience in container technologies (Docker, Kubernetes) or public cloud environments
  • Good understanding of Linux operating systems, Infrastructure as Code (Terraform, ARM) and test automation
  • Skills in agile software development (e.g. Scrum), usage of relevant DevOps Tools, build management and test automation
  • goal-oriented and self-reliant
  • Interest in current and emerging IT cloud technologies
  • Adapting to newer technologies, different tools and frameworks
  • Strong presentation, verbal communication and written communications skills
  • enthusiastic, good team player, flexible, responsible
